Betgarh Population - Sambalpur, Orissa

Betgarh is a medium size village located in Rairakhol Block of Sambalpur district, Orissa with total 97 families residing. The Betgarh village has population of 463 of which 239 are males while 224 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Betgarh village population of children with age 0-6 is 62 which makes up 13.39 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Betgarh village is 937 which is lower than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Betgarh as per census is 632, lower than Orissa average of 941.

Betgarh village has lower liter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Betgarh village was 70.32 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Betgarh Male literacy stands at 80.60 % while female literacy rate was 60.00 %.

Betgarh Data

Particulars Total Male Female
Total No. of Houses 97 - -
Population 463 239 224
Child (0-6) 62 38 24
Schedule Caste 27 16 11
Schedule Tribe 53 25 28
Literacy 70.32 % 80.60 % 60.00 %
Total Workers 266 136 130
Main Worker 176 - -
Marginal Worker 90 21 69

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 11.45 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 5.83 % of total population in Betgarh village.

Work Profile

In Betgarh village out of total population, 266 were engaged in work activities. 66.17 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 33.83 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 266 workers engaged in Main Work, 85 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 21 were Agricultural labourer.
